Nigeria, The Niger Delta and the Nigerian Government
Nigeria might be rich in resources; its population lives in poverty. With a Multidimensional Poverty
Index (MPI) of .31, it was ranked number 157 out of the 186 United Nations (UN) member states in
2012. Also, according to the World Bank, the poverty headcount ratio was 68%, meaning this part of
the population lived with less than $1.25 a day in 2010.
The Niger Delta is one of the nine states of the Federal Republic of Nigeria. It counts about 20 million
people and around 70 000 km² of land. The region is one of the most prominent wetlands in the world.
Oil has produced about $600 billion since the 1960 s.
Despite its wealth in resources, the majority of the people live under poor conditions. To counter this
poverty, the Nigerian government has set up several commissions in the past. The most prominent are
the Oil Mineral Producing Areas Development Commission (OMPADEC) and the Niger Delta
Development Commission (NDDC).
The OMPADEC was established in 1993 and focused on the development of the Niger Delta Region
(NDR). It however failed due to factors as corruption, mismanagement and non sufficient funding.
Hereafter, the NDDC was to replace the OMPADEC. It would create socio economic development in
the NDR. The NDDC set up various projects in the region. However, due to the poor structure of the
organisation and inadequate funding the NDDC have

Human Migration Is A Major Function Of Rabs As Tumor Cell...
More than 60 Rab GTPases have been found, and they each have a particular function in vesicular
transport in a cell (Hutagalung and Novick, 2011). For example, Rab 27a and Rab27b are of particular
interest in melanoma due to their function of melanosome transport. (Figure 5) Rab27a has been
identified as a tumour dependency gene in melanoma (Akavia et al., 2010).
1.4.2 Roles of Rab proteins in cancer
Depending on the tumour cell type, there will be differing expression of Rabs. For example, Rab31
overexpression is linked to a poorer outcome in breast cancer (Kotzsch, et al. 2008) and Rab2 is linked
to progression in lung cancer (Culine et al., 1994). However, other Rabs are seen to be down
regulated, such as Rab38 in melanoma compared to normal melanocytes, thus have a key role
(Mueller, Rehli, Bosserhoff, 2009).
Promoting migration is a major function of Rabs as tumour cells need to be able to invade ECM and
migrate to other sites. Rabs, especially Rab25, have roles in trafficking and recycling integrins, which
are cell adhesion molecules providing linkage of cells to the ECM (Arnaout, Goodman and Xiong,
2007), to invasion structures to facilitate migration (Recchi, and Seabra, 2012).
ECM degradation and remodeling is essential to tumour cell invasion and migration. Rabs have a
major role in secretion and activation of mat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s) at the tip of invasion
structures such as invadopodia. Rabs regulate a the secretion of a variety of MMPs. Rab7 and Rab8

Abraham Maslow Hierarchy Of Hierarchy
Abraham Maslow, who was a humanistic psychologist, argued that needs are arranged in a ladder like
steps. He proposed a rising order of needs from the level of physiological to self transcendence. The
order of needs starts from basic survival or lower order needs to higher order needs. As one level of
need is satisfied another higher order need will emerge and assume importance in life. The hierarchy
is shown in Fig. Physiological needs: The most potent and lowest level of all the needs are
physiological needs. Thus the needs of hunger, thirst, sex, temperature regulation and rest occupy the
lowest step in the ladder. According to Maslow, when these physiological needs are deprived for a
long period, all other needs fail to appear We must eat 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
Safety needs are mainly concerned with maintaining order and security, to feel secure, safe and out of
danger. Love and Belongingness needs: These are the needs of making intimate relationship with other
members of the society. People want to become an accepted member of an organised group, need a
familiar environment such as family. These needs are dependent on the fulfilment and satisfaction of
physiological and safety needs. The Esteem needs: Esteem needs are divided into the following two
categories: (a) Needs related to respect from others like reputation, status, social success and fame.
The need of self evaluation occurs in those persons who are comfortably situated and satisfied with
the fulfilment of lower order needs. For example, a competent professional who has established a high
reputation and does not have to worry about getting a job, may become quite choosy about what type
of work he/she would accept. (b) Self esteem, self respect and self regard. The other type of esteem
needs include need to achieve, to be competent, to gain approval and to get recognition. The need to
feel superior to others also falls under this category. For fulfilling this, a person may buy good quality
and costly

Introduction. The problems in this chapter examine some variations on the apartment market described
in the text. In most of the problems we work with the true demand curve constructed from the
reservation prices of the consumers rather than the smoothed demand curve that we used in the text.
Remember that the reservation price of a consumer is that price where he is just indifferent between
renting or not renting the apartment. At any price below the reservation price the consumer will
demand one apartment, at any price above the reservation price the consumer will demand zero
apartments, and exactly at the reservation price the consumer will be indifferent between having zero
or one apartment. You should 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
